What is Search Engine Optimization (SEO)?

Search engine optimization (SEO), also known as search engine marketing is the process of improving your website to rank higher in organic results. It also helps to attract visitors who convert to customers or clients.

On-page SEO is the process of improving the metadata and content on a website to improve its rank in the search engine results. This involves changing the title of the webpage and using schema markup to display important information.

Keywords

Keywords in SEO are words or phrases that users enter into search engines to locate relevant information. When used correctly, keywords can bring visitors to a site by making it appear in organic search results. Keywords can be used in the title, description and tags of a webpage or video blog post. It is essential to keep in mind that keywords should be in line with the intention of the user, not just the content of the website.

The process of selecting the most appropriate keywords involves research as well as experimentation. The first step is to think about keywords and write the list of keywords that your audience might use to find your product or service. Use a tool such as Ubersuggest to get a better idea of the terms that are in high demand. Once you have compiled your list of keywords, eliminate any irrelevant or Search Engine Optimization Uk redundant keywords.

Think about limiting the number principal keywords you employ on each page of your website. This should be done with careful balance of relevancy and difficulty. Find semantically related terms and long-tail modifying words to help support these keywords. Include a few "carrot keywords" such as "reliable guarantee," which will increase your site engagement and conversions, but won't affect your search engine rankings.

Understanding the patterns of your target audience's searches and how they find the products or services you offer is essential to SEO. The use of the right keywords in your content will help you get higher rankings on search engine result pages (SERPs) and connect your customers to your company. This is the most effective method of driving traffic to a website.

Content

Content of high quality is a great way to increase traffic. Utilizing keywords in your content is crucial for being found on the internet However, you must also to create unique content that meets searchers' intent. This means writing about subjects that are relevant to your audience and using keywords in a natural way. You can include LSI keywords that are related to words and phrases related to your main keyword.

The aim of SEO is to optimize your website for users and Search Engine Optimization Uk engines alike. This means optimizing both the content (text on your site) that users see and the code behind it. It also means using your h1 and H2 tags to optimize your article with keywords and ensuring your URLs contain your main keyword. Additionally, you should ensure that your content is free of grammatical mistakes and that it is relevant to the subject matter you're trying to rank for.

Search engines are increasingly focused on user experience and quality content as they continue to evolve. This includes factors such as the mobile-friendly design and avoiding ads that are intrusive. It also includes technical elements like schema markup, which is a set of guidelines that search engines use to better comprehend the structure and significance of web pages. In addition to these technical elements, Google has also trained human content evaluators to evaluate the quality of its results in search. These guidelines are known as E.E.A.T. They emphasize the expertise and experience of websites, as well as their authority and trustworthiness. Link building

Google's ranking in search optimization results is affected by a myriad of factors. They include quality content and mobile responsiveness, SEO and more. Many brands understand and are aware of these aspects of their online business, but one area that is often overlooked is link building. This is an important part of SEO and it can affect your website's ranking. There are some low-quality link building strategies that can actually harm your SEO, so it's crucial to be aware of them and how to avoid them.

A link is an clickable text that will take you to another page of your website. Backlinks are also known as links and are among the most important ranking factors for a website. It's also a great method to increase traffic since people are more likely to click on your link if they see it on other websites. This can result in an increase in number of visitors to your site.

Quantity is not as important as quality when it comes down to the creation of links. A quality profile of links is made up of links from websites that are relevant to your niche. It's also beneficial to include various types of links, like image links and internal hyperlinks. It is equally important to choose the appropriate anchor text. Generic phrases such as "click here" or "read more" don't add any value to your link's profile, so it is best to use branded anchor text.

There are a myriad of ways to increase the number of links you have such as guest blogging, making infographics, writing articles about industry and submitting your site to web directories. These methods can help you reach your goals, but they should be carefully executed to avoid being considered spam. Google has cracked down on these tactics. They can harm your search engine optimization if used incorrectly.

A good link-building strategy is focused on both the quality of the links as well as the authority (or authority) of the site that is linking to you. The popularity and trustworthiness of the site linking to you may affect your rankings. A link from a popular, authoritative site is more influential than one from a less-popular and less trustworthy site.

Analytics

Analytics tools can be used to evaluate the effectiveness of SEO efforts. These tools allow you to monitor metrics such as organic traffic, pages-per-visit, and goal conversions. They can also help you identify SEO issues, such as slow site speeds or low click-through rates. There are many tools to help you track your website's performance, such as Google Analytics, Search Console, Moz, SEMRush, Ahrefs and more.

A key metric to consider is your bounce rate, which determines the percentage of visitors who leave your site after completing a page. The lower your bounce rate is, the more effective. This metric can be useful in determining what kinds of content your users enjoy and will aid in optimizing your website to improve it in the future.

Another important metric to keep track of is your SERP features that are the additional features that appear on a search engine results page (SERP) in addition to organic listings. These features can enhance the credibility of your listing and increase the likelihood that people will click on it. To enhance your SERP features, make sure they match the purpose of the search and are relevant to the user's experience.

Google Search Console's "Performance Tab" lets you monitor your SERP features. You can also view your visibility index. This is calculated based on click through rates and shows you how often your website is featured in the top 100 search results for the keywords that you are tracking.

The SERP feature metric can give you an idea of how your SEO strategy is working. However, it is important to be aware that it isn't necessarily an exact ranking signal. It's a great way to see what your competition is doing and what kind of content they produce.

Another metric you can track is your CTR which is the percentage of visitors that result in the user clicking through to your site. This metric can be monitored directly through Google Search Console, under the heading of "Performance Module". You can view the data for each page, query, or device. This is an excellent way to find out which pages aren't making the cut, and can aid in determining what changes should be implemented.
